With the release of MTA 1.0.4, support for external resource hosting is finally working 100% - we've enabled it on both the AGS and DRuG MTADM Race 1.0.4 servers.
File transfers in game now fly in, with the resources being hosted from the AGS web server, thanks to [DRuG]Mouldy and the AGS crew - the 5Gb per day of bandwidth used on my home link should be reduced as a result. As an added bonus, the speed of transferring resources in game from this new server is a lot faster, and leaves the game server free to concentrate on player synch.. less players are timing out which has resulted in lots more people joining 24/7.

MTADM 1.0 resource release: Colour by [DRuG]NikT
[DRuG]NikT (25 Sep 2009 04:43 am)
Based on Colorlights by eXo|SpeedY
Released with full permission from SpeedY - thanks mate!
Commands:
/colour 0-255 0-255 0-255 0-126 0-126 0-126 0-126
eg. For aqua headlights and a black car..
/colour 0 142 102 0 0 0 0
- the first 3 are the light's RGB, then the 4 GTA car colours
- only the first two are used by most cars
- blank fields become a random colour
/colour - Toggle random light and car colours
/drug - Purple Lights (102, 51, 255) black/pink/white/purple car
/disco - Lights randomly change colour on black/white car
/discocar - Lights and car colour change rapidly like KWOW.
Background:
With full permission from Speedy, I have taken his colorlights v2.5 mod and added lots more code.
This new mod from it, called "colour", manages the "Timer" threads better - cleans them up as the player leaves.
The only time errors now appear in the console is when switching between race rounds and when a player is dead awaiting respawn.. I am sure there's some kind of check I will eventually find to remove these errors, too.. but at this stage, it's still cleaner than it was.
It works between rounds, re-checking the player vehicle and re-applying the lights after map changes. All toggles work on each other, so /drug can disable /colour etc.
I have added support for daytime lights, using the lightsoverride function, also added randomizing car colours, like the lights, using /discocar.

To support this, I will be compiling the nightly builds as they are released, then updating both the AGS and DRuG servers accordingly.
To obtain the latest client and data files required to play, pop over to
http://nightly.mtasa.com.
In other news, [DRuG]Dabombber has just updated ALAR to 1.3.
- Added: (amount) parameter to /arepair, requires player parameter to be entered
- Added: /acarcolour command
- Added: /aipupdate command
- Added: /aspectating command
- Added: Additonal RCON commands
- Added: Chat history for joining players (/ahistory)
- Added: Enabled going to a player from spec using the look behind key (requires agoto privlages)
- Added: OnAlarInit() and OnAlarExit() callbacks, and GetAlarVersion() function
- Added: Option to check for invalid vehicle mods (CHECKMODS compile setting)
- Added: Option to enable extra spectate views (ExtraSpecViews INI setting)
- Added: Players in the server who are immune to the ping kicker can be viewed with the /aimmune command
- Added: Spectate HUD setting is saved
- Added: SuspendPlayer() and BanPlayer() functions
- Added: Whitelist from range bans (/awhitelist /aunwhitelist)
- Changed: /asetname and /aloginas so banned or suspended names cannot be used
- Changed: How admins spawn from spec (added SetSpawnType() function) and how jailed players spawn
- Changed: Locahost and LAN IP address no longer show as Unknown
- Changed: Players with the same IP as a player banned or suspended with /aban or /asuspend are kicked from the server (KickAllIPs INI setting)
- Changed: Ranges bans/suspensions can have a different message (RangeBanMsg/RangeSuspensionMsg INI settings)
- Changed: Spectating admins will view the closest player in their virtual world if their current player dies (with no killer) or leaves
- Changed: The ping kicker can now be disabled by setting the max ping to 0 or less
- Fixed: Added password length check to RCON account creation
- Fixed: Join textdraws not appearing for joining players
- Fixed: Restricted spawning where you look in free spec to only admins who can right click teleport
- Fixed: Set virtual world and interior of passengers when using /agoto and /abring

This mod is now into it's second revision, and one of DRuG's more epic releases in the San Andreas era, so I felt perhaps I should make an announcement about it, such that it doesn't get missed.
Giving us the ability to manage SAMP servers, delegate admins, use advanced admin scripting etc that is not shipped as part of samp, but expected to be within whatever modes the server runs, ALAR is an essential part of any busy SAMP server.
Much like but a totally different beast to [UVA]Scooby's PRS for MTA Race administration, this spells epic things for samp servers.
New in version 1.2, which has just been released:
* Fixed background alpha in admin logs
* Changed so using 0 as the colour uses the default colour
* Changed /aflip to put out the fires on vehicles
* Fixed newline in reason when unsuspending/unbanning
* Multiple adminchat prefixes now possible using | as a seperator eg) "@|#|//"
* Fixed ban/suspend messages not showing with some gamemodes using YSF
* Added "Admins Spectating" to /asinfo
* Added "paused" to spec hud
* Added log message when a permanently muted/jailed/frozen player joins
* Fixed the spectate HUD so it updates when /asetname is used
* Added /alog to toggle admin log keys enabled and to change the log page
